Course Outline

Introduction to Power BI

  • An overview of Power BI Desktop and Power BI Service.
  • Exploring the core elements: reports, datasets, and dashboards.
  • Reviewing available data connectivity options.

Data Integration and Preparation

  • Retrieving data from Excel files, CSVs, and cloud platforms.
  • Performing initial data transformations using the Power Query Editor.
  • Refining and structuring data for optimal visual analysis.

Crafting Impactful Visuals

  • Selecting appropriate chart types to match your data requirements.
  • Designing tables, scorecards, and key performance indicators (KPIs).
  • Incorporating slicers and filters to enhance interactivity.

Constructing Dynamic Dashboards

  • Assembling individual visuals into a unified dashboard layout.
  • Implementing themes, layout structures, and design best practices.
  • Enabling drill-through features and cross-filter interactions.

Distribution and Collaboration

  • Exporting and publishing reports to the Power BI Service.
  • Setting up workspaces and defining access permissions.
  • Sharing dashboards and embedding reports into external platforms.

Practical Workshop

  • Developing a full dashboard from a provided sample dataset.
  • Adjusting visual interactions and filtering mechanisms.
  • Presenting findings and sharing outcomes with key stakeholders.
